Vertical fiscal imbalances and fiscal performance in advanced economies
Authors:Luc Eyraud  Lusine Lusinyan
Institution:1. International Monetary Fund, Fiscal Affairs Department, 700 19th Street, N.W., Washington, DC 20431, USA;2. International Monetary Fund, Western Hemisphere Department, 700 19th Street, N.W., Washington, DC 20431, USA
Abstract:The paper examines empirically, using a measure of “vertical fiscal imbalances” (VFI), the relationship between overall fiscal performance and the financing structure of subnational governments. It presents stylized facts regarding the size, evolution, and components of measured VFI using data from 28 OECD countries. On average, the general government fiscal balance is found to improve by 1 percent of GDP for each 10 percentage point reduction in VFI.
